Understanding the Contract Rate Calculator

A contract rate calculator is a tool designed to help freelancers determine their hourly, daily, or project-based rates based on various factors such as desired annual income, expenses, billable hours, and desired profit margin. These calculators utilize algorithms to crunch numbers and provide you with a recommended rate that aligns with your financial goals and market standards.

How to Use a Contract Rate Calculator

  1. Gather Financial Information: Before using a contract rate calculator, gather information such as your desired annual income, business expenses (e.g., software subscriptions, equipment costs, overhead), and billable hours per week.
  2. Input Data: Enter the gathered data into the calculator. Be as accurate and realistic as possible to ensure reliable results.
  3. Adjust Parameters: Some calculators allow you to adjust parameters such as desired profit margin or vacation days. Tweak these settings to align with your preferences.
  4. Review Results: Once you’ve inputted all necessary information, review the calculated rates provided by the calculator. Consider factors such as market rates and your level of expertise when assessing the recommendations.
  5. Refine as Necessary: Use the calculated rates as a starting point, but be willing to refine them based on market feedback, project complexity, and your evolving skill set.
